1. Rotary vs. Magnetic Motors
Understanding motors is key to choosing your gear. Magnetic motor clippers run at high speeds, producing smooth cuts, and are ideal for dry hair. Pivot motors run at lower speeds but have double the power, making them great for wet, thick hair. Rotary motor clippers are the versatile workhorses, offering high power and speed to handle any hair type.
2. Corded vs. Cordless Convenience
Corded clippers offer uninterrupted power, ensuring you never run out of juice mid-fade. Cordless clippers, however, offer unmatched maneuverability and convenience, letting you work around the chair with complete freedom. Modern lithium-ion batteries now offer hours of run time, making cordless a popular choice in busy shops.

4. Essential Clipper Maintenance
To keep your clippers running smoothly and ensure client safety, establish a daily maintenance routine. Brush away hair debris after every cut, apply clipper oil to the blades, and sanitize using professional sprays. Regular maintenance prevents blade wear and keeps the motor running cool.
